Output e8ec814edccfa8a9f1e90ee77cbc66bb320a03735877b737cd1e1df70fb227c9:0

value
17978900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0db82d86f51e82b03f1e751bbd14e3939f884862 OP_EQUALVERIFY OP_CHECKSIG
address
12FYRPt6qRYTUFGpDybCuUzsnM6BeVi66C
transaction
e8ec814edccfa8a9f1e90ee77cbc66bb320a03735877b737cd1e1df70fb227c9
confirmations
388105
spent
true